WP-LITE
PURPOSE: to make the Video Display Editor look and feel more like
Word Perfect.
CONTENTS: WP.BAT : start up file which loads VDE along with your
document in /P mode.
WP.HLP : Text file used by WPHLP.EXE
WPHLP.EXE : program run by VDE which shows four help
screens similar to those in WP 4.2.
WP.VDF : function key definition file. Based on the
original WP.VDF by Eric Meyer.
HOW TO: To use WP-LITE, put the above files in a working
directory on your disk. VDE (ver 1.54 or better) may be
anywhere on the PATH in you computer.
At the DOS command prompt, type WP filename.ext and press
Enter.
When editing, press the F3 key and you will get the first
of four help screens that will give you help in learning
the key board for WP-LITE.
Note that some of the function keys have definitions that
do not conform to the WP standard. This is because,
there is no corresponding function in VDE.
